About Jenny Xie

Jenny Xie is a scholar working on Immunology, Physiology and Oncology, having authored 19 papers that have together received 1.8k indexed citations. Recurring topics across this work include Immune Cell Function and Interaction (6 papers), Sphingolipid Metabolism and Signaling (6 papers), Lipid Membrane Structure and Behavior (3 papers), Chemokine receptors and signaling (3 papers), Immunotherapy and Immune Responses (3 papers), Monoclonal and Polyclonal Antibodies Research (3 papers), T-cell and B-cell Immunology (3 papers) and Immune Response and Inflammation (2 papers). The work is most often cited by research in Immunology (678 citations), Molecular Biology (1.3k citations) and Physiology (75 citations). Jenny Xie has collaborated with scholars based in United States, Sweden and China. Frequent co-authors include Hugh Rosen, Elizabeth J. Quackenbush, Kathleen M. Rupprecht, Gan-Ju Shei, William H. Parsons, James A. Milligan, Mark Rosenbach, Jeffrey J. Hale, James D. Bergstrom and Suzanne Mandala. Their work appears in journals such as Science, The Journal of Immunology and Gastroenterology.
